I recently purchase a used cx600. It only has one controller and one enclosure. I am having a problem adding new drives to it. I was able to setup the initial 5 drives with the config and ip config. If the enclosure only has the 5 drives everything is ok but as soon as I add a new drive the system goes into fault and will not see any of the new drives. The drives keep saying E status for empty. I checked the fault on the system and i'm getting the following Bus 0 Enclosure 0 : Faulted.

Thanks
 
When you say "controller" are you referring to 1 service process or 1 LCC?

If the 2 clarrion service processors disagree, it will use the higher of the 2 errors... for example if SPA can see the new disk, but SPB cant... the result will be that the disk is Empty. Both Service processors need to agree that the new disk is online and available for configuration.
 
It sounds like you are putting in either bad disks or incompatible disks. What was your source for the disks you are adding?
 
I agree with falcon, try updating the flarecode and check the compatability matrix to check the drive numbers are support in your current flarecode revision.
